Output 50d0106ca76f8247a1ec5b5dc374c4013c9fd88d01d64b60e5dbb51ccd86863c:15

value
499900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69abb65b91fd1dbc8847337955738983eca79279 OP_EQUAL
address
3BKkaU72s78AmUoN7rAwrex8ZdCHrkhTb9
transaction
50d0106ca76f8247a1ec5b5dc374c4013c9fd88d01d64b60e5dbb51ccd86863c
spent
true